Auto Mode

Shooting in the Auto Mode

In the A (auto) mode, you can set image mode, white balance, continuous shooting,
color options and distortion control in the shooting menu, and take pictures.
1
Press A to display the shooting-
mode selection menu.
• The shooting-mode selection menu will be
displayed.
2
Press the multi selector H or I to choose A
and press k.
• The camera enters A (auto) mode.
• Press d to select an option from the shooting menu
(A 77).
3
Frame the subject and shoot.
• Raise the built-in flash when using the
flash.
• Camera focuses on subject in center of
frame.

Focus Lock
When the camera focuses on an object in the center of the frame, you can use focus lock to focus on an off-center subject.
• Be sure that the distance between the camera and the subject does not change while focus is locked.
• When the shutter-release button is pressed halfway, exposure is locked.

Available Functions in A (Auto) Mode
In addition to the items in shooting menu, flash mode (A 30) can be changed and self-timer
(A 33), macro mode (A 34) and exposure compensation (A 35) can be applied.
